Описание сегодняшних обновлений, вероятно, будет через пару дней. Про новый модуль календарей появится пост от автора.
И так, начнем!
[spoiler]
Главный модуль 11.0.11
Рейтинги: добавлена возможность голосовать сразу после регистрации
До этого обновления у зарегистрировавшегося пользователя возможность голосовать появлялась через час (при пересчете рейтингов агентами), теперь новые пользователи могут голосовать сразу после регистрации.
Незначительные изменения и исправления
Обновлен шаблон компонента “Журнал изменений” (bitrix:event_list). Фильтр вынесен над списком записей об изменениях и может быть использован в БУСе без дополнительной модификации шаблона.
Исправлена ошибка загрузки файлов на серверах с настроенной опцией open_basedir.
Динамическое сохранение настроек интерфейса при помощи BX.userOptions теперь корректно работает для всех авторизованных пользователей.
Исправления в парсере: исправлено вложенное цитирование, изменена проверка валидности пути картинки.
В проверку сайта добавлен тест “Загрузка файла через php://input”. Описание теста можно найти на странице проверки сайта.
Задачи 11.0.3
Незначительные исправления
Новый вид задач в ЖЛ.
В форме просмотра задачи “над порталом” добавлены пункты в меню действий:
Добавлено действие task2activity для постановки задачи в бизнес-процессе (
Постановщик теперь может закрыть отклоненную задачу (появляется ссылка “
В сообщении соц.сети об изменении задачи не будет неверной даты ”Крайний срок: 01.01.1970 03:00”, если из задачи удаляется крайний срок.
При скачивании файлов, прикрепленных к шаблону задачи, название скачанного файла теперь остается таким же, как у припленного.
Переиндексация (из админки) расставляет правильные права доступа к комментариям задач, добавленные комментарии появляются в поиске для нужных людей.
Конструктор отчетов 11.0.3
Добавлено копирование и удаление отчетов
Из списка отчетов теперь можно создать или удалить отчет.
Постраничный вывод в результирующем отчете
В компонент bitrix:report.view добавлена возможность вывода отчета с постраничной навигацией.
Добавлена возможность изменять сортировку в результирующем отчете
В компоненте bitrix:report.view появилась возможность изменять сортировку по столбцам отчета.
Добавлена возможность задавать формат ФИО сотрудника в результирующем отчете
Компонент bitrix:report.view теперь может принимать формат имени.
Исправлен ряд ошибок
Исправлена JS ошибка, возникающая при настройке фильтра в форме создания отчета.
Еще: Добавлен новый типовой отчет “Отчет по эффективности”.
Библиотека документов 11.0.5
Исправлены незначительные ошибки
Исправлена ошибка, вызывающая проблемы с работой с папками, в названии которых присутсвуют кирилические символы, в utf установках.
Исправлена ошибка в установках cp1251: при запуске БП для файла, расположенного в папке с кирилическим названием, осуществлялся некорректный редирект, БП не запускался.
Исправлена ошибка "Тип параметра не определен", возникающая при загрузке документа по БП, в шаблоне которого есть корректно настроенный параметр типа "Привязка к элементам в виде списка".
Расширенные права: при запуске БП в рамках библиотеки документов диалог выбора пользователя не позволял выбрать пользователей, которые должны принять участие в БП. Для пользователя с ограниченными правами на библиотеку отображается сообщение “Доступ запрещен”, для админа – в списке только админы.
Расширенные права: пользователь с правом на "Ограниченное изменение", не мог удалить загруженный им же файл.
Учет рабочего времени 11.0.7
Изменения в отчетах по рабочему времени
Осуществляется синхронизация данных (начало, завершение рабочего дня, отчет за день, задачи на день и тд.) интерфейса учета рабочего времени. Если у вас открыто несколько вкладок с окном учета, то, например, сделав перерыв рабочего дня в одной владке, в остальных - учет рабочего времени будет тоже показывать перерыв. Синхронизация осуществляется в браузерах с localStorage.
Добавлен публичный интерфейс настройки учета рабочего времени для сотрудников и подразделений.
Интерфейс уже описан в
Добавлено новое свойство для пользователей и отделов “Допустимый промежуток изменения времени” - насколько сотрудник может изменить время начала или окончания рабочего дня, чтобы это не требовало подтверждения руководителем. Например, если значение параметра равно 30 мин., то сотрудник, открывая в 9.00 рабочий день с другим временем, может установить время начала от 8.30 до 9.00, и это не будет требовать подтверждения, если же он поставит 8.20, то такой рабочий день потребует подтверждения руководителя.
Рабочие дни, требующие подтверждения руководителем, теперь отражаются в ЖЛ. Для руководителей в ЖЛ в удобном формате представляются записи о необходимости подтверждения рабочих дней подчиненных. Отсюда можно перейти на страницу с отчетом по рабочему времени сотрудников, просмотреть в деталях конкретный день, требующий подтверждения, потдердить его, а также настроить уведомления для данного типа событий.
Компонент “Отчет по рабочему времени” (bitrix:timeman.report) сохраняет настройки фильтра каждого пользователя.
В настройках модуля появился параметр “Путь к странице отчета по рабочему времени” используемый для построения правильных ссылок на отчеты из ЖЛ.
Изменения в рабочих отчетах
Изменен интерфейс настройки периодичности рабочих отчетов.
Форма написания отчета за период не будет показана, если за отчетный период пользователь ни разу не открывал рабочий день. Т.е. пользователям не нужно писать отчет за выходные, отпуск, больничный и тд, если они совпали с отчетным периодом.
Отчеты за интервал времени теперь могут быть необязательны.
В рабочие отчеты можно загружать файлы.
Компонент "Отчеты по работе сотрудников" (bitrix:timeman.report.weekly) сохраняет настройки фильтра каждого пользователя.
Добавлен счетчик комментариев в компоненте отчетов.
Кстати, комментарии могут быть добавлены, используя не только кнопку “Отправить”, но и сочетание клавиш Ctrl+Enter.
Теперь при создании отчета осуществляется автоматическая подписка на него - сообщения по XMPP для автора отчета и для руководителя. Подписка осуществляется на отчеты конкретного пользователя.
В настройках модуля появился параметр “Путь к странице рабочих отчетов”, используемый для построения правильных ссылок на отчеты из ЖЛ.
Фото:
У руководителя пропала возможность корректировать затраченное время на задачу сотрудника. Это баг или фича? Несмотря на все доводы "за" и "против" такого мелкгого функционала, очень хотелось бы видеть его. Сейчас получается, что если несколько задач будут стоять на выполнении полдня, то суммарное время выполнения задач может оказаться в разы больше длительности рабочего дня.
Понимаю, что проработать логику КП для избежания таких ситуаций сложно, но дать компаниям возможность решить вопрос вручную было бы весьма кстати.
Интересует с практической стороны - ждать ли фнукционал в коробке или реализовать самим. Лишнюю работу делать ой как не хочется.
Пока, установив модуль в лаборатории, не смог даже завести событие, ибо ругается на некорректную дату начала события, с чего-то вдруг ("Дата начала события не введена или введена некорректно"), хотя всё там в порядке. Завёл задачу - календарь её так же не отразил. Пытался нажать на кнопку соединения с мобильными устройствами - тоже безрезультатно.
зы. как же меня утомило:
Единственное - теперь появилась необходимость опции у задачи "Не отображать в календаре" (возможно - отдельная опция для нее "рекурсивно"). Используем некоторые задачи в качестве агрегаторов более мелких, размечая таким образом определенные этапы работ - весьма напрягает двухнедельная полоса, особенно когда их под десяток.
Или сделать какую-то кастомизацию по отображению задач уже в календаре - типа "отметьте те задачи, которые необходимо отображать".